The paddy straw mushroom is having good combinations of all attributes like flavour, aroma, delicacy, high content of protein and vitamins and minerals, because of which, the acceptability of this mushroom is no way less than much popular white button mushroom. It is an edible mushroom of the topics and subtropics, and began to be cultivated in China as early as 1822. Around 1932-, the straw mushroom was introduced into the Philippines, Malaysia, and other south-east Asian countries by overseas Chinese. Since then, its cultivation has been conducted in various countries outside of the region. The fruiting body formation starts with tiny clusters of white hyphal aggregates called primordia and it is followed by several morphological stages in the fruiting body development process. The successive stages are called as "button", "eggs", "elongation", "mature" stages respectively. Differentiation can be seen first at the 'button' stage. At maturity the buttons enlarge and umbrella like fruit bodies emerge after the rupture of the volva.
